MACHINE_MODE_DEF_MASK Columns |
ColumnName | Domain | Datatype | NULL | Definition |
DVC_TYPE_ID | Device Id | VARCHAR2(50) | NO | Device Identifier: The unique identifier for the device. The identifier consists of the concatenation of the following fields: System ID, Subsystem ID, Device Qualifier, Device Type and Device Instance. |
DVC_TYPE_SGNL_NM | Signal Name | VARCHAR2(50) | YES | Input Signal Name: The signal name that carries the trip information to the channel. |
INPUT_SGNL_NONTRIP_VAL | VARCHAR2(10) | YES | Input Signal Good Value: The binary value of the trip isgnal in it's good state. This is necessary because there is not consistency across the signals. In some cases 0 indicates a good state and in others it indicates a trip. |
|
ANALOG_SGNL_NM | Signal Name | VARCHAR2(50) | YES | Trip Signal Name: The analog signal id if the trip input signal is being derived from an analog signal. |
SW_JUMP | Indicator | CHAR(1) | NO | Software Jumper: |
BEAM_OFF | Machine Mode Ind | RAW(1) | NO | Beam Off: Indicates all systems are off. |
STANDBY | Machine Mode Ind | RAW(1) | NO | Standby: Indicates the system is in warm standby mode. |
MPS_TEST | Machine Mode Ind | RAW(1) | NO | MPS Test: MPS Test Mode Indicator |
SRC_10US | Machine Mode Ind | RAW(1) | NO | Source 10 US: SRC Only - Empty channels default to 1, Otherwise default = 0 |
SRC_50US | Machine Mode Ind | RAW(1) | NO | Source 50 US: SRC Only |
SRC_100US | Machine Mode Ind | RAW(1) | NO | Source 100 US: SRC Only |
SRC_1MS | Machine Mode Ind | RAW(1) | NO | Source 1ms: SRC Only |
SRC_FULLPWR | Machine Mode Ind | RAW(1) | NO | Source Full Power: SRC Only |
DTL_10US | Machine Mode Ind | RAW(1) | NO | TL 10 US |
DTL_50US | Machine Mode Ind | RAW(1) | NO | TL 50 US |
DTL_100US | Machine Mode Ind | RAW(1) | NO | TL 100 US |
DTL_2KW | Machine Mode Ind | RAW(1) | NO | TL 2 KW |
DTL_FULLPWR | Machine Mode Ind | RAW(1) | NO | TL Full Power |
LDMP_10US | Machine Mode Ind | RAW(1) | NO | Linac Dump 10us: Indicates a 10us beam to the Linac Dump. |
LDMP_50US | Machine Mode Ind | RAW(1) | NO | Linac Dump 50 US: Indicates a50us beam to the Linac Dump. |
LDMP_100US | Machine Mode Ind | RAW(1) | NO | Linac Dump 100 US: Indicates a 100us beam to the Linac Dump. |
LDMP_7_5KW | Machine Mode Ind | RAW(1) | NO | Linac Dump 7.5 KW: Indicates a 7.5kw beam to the Linac Dump. |
LDMP_FULLPWR | Machine Mode Ind | RAW(1) | NO | Linac Dump Full Power: Indicates a full power beam to the Linac Dump. |
IDMP_10US | Machine Mode Ind | RAW(1) | NO | Injection Dump 10 US: Indicates a 10us beam to the Injection Dump. |
IDMP_50US | Machine Mode Ind | RAW(1) | NO | Injection Dump 50 US: Indicates a 50us beam to the Injection Dump. |
IDMP_100US | Machine Mode Ind | RAW(1) | NO | Injection Dump 100 US: Indicates a 100us beam to the Injection Dump. |
IDMP_1MS | Machine Mode Ind | RAW(1) | NO | Injection Dump 1 MS: Indicates a 1ms beam to the Injection Dump. |
IDMP_FULLPWR | Machine Mode Ind | RAW(1) | NO | Injection Dump Full Power: Indicates a full power beam to the Injection Dump. |
RING_10US | Machine Mode Ind | RAW(1) | NO | Ring Storage Mode 10 US: Indicates a 10us ring storage mode. |
RING_50US | Machine Mode Ind | RAW(1) | NO | Ring Storage Mode 50 US: Indicates a 50us ring storage mode. |
RING_100US | Machine Mode Ind | RAW(1) | NO | Ring Storage Mode 100 US: Indicates a 100us ring storage mode. |
RING_7_5MW | Machine Mode Ind | RAW(1) | NO | Ring Storage Mode 7.5 MW: Indicates a 7.5 mw ring storage mode. |
RING_FULLPWR | Machine Mode Ind | RAW(1) | NO | Ring Storage Mode Full Power: Indicates a full power ring storage mode. |
EDMP_10US | Machine Mode Ind | RAW(1) | NO | Extraction Dump 10 US: Indicates a 10us beam to the extraction dump. |
EDMP_50US | Machine Mode Ind | RAW(1) | NO | Exctraction Dump 50 US: Indicates a 50us beam to the extraction dump. |
EDMP_100US | Machine Mode Ind | RAW(1) | NO | Extraction Dump 100 US: Indicates a 100us beam to the extraction dump. |
EDMP_7_5MW | Machine Mode Ind | RAW(1) | NO | Extraction Dump 7.5 MW: Indicates a7.5mw beam to the extraction dump. |
EDMP_FULLPWR | Machine Mode Ind | RAW(1) | NO | Extraction Dump Full Power: Indicates a full power beam to the extraction dump. |
TARGET_10US | Machine Mode Ind | RAW(1) | NO | Target 10 US: Indicates a 10us beam to the target. |
TARGET_50US | Machine Mode Ind | RAW(1) | NO | Target 50 US: Indicates a 50us beam to the target. |
TARGET_100US | Machine Mode Ind | RAW(1) | NO | Target 100 US: Indicates a100us beam to the target. |
TARGET_1MS | Machine Mode Ind | RAW(1) | NO | Target 1MS: Indicates a 1ms beam to the target. |
TARGET_FULLPWR | Machine Mode Ind | RAW(1) | NO | Target Full Power: Indicates a full power beam to the target. |
